I've heard boundaries explained like this. Imagine sexual sin is a big, deep hole in the ground. The closer you get, the more chances are you'll fall into it. Having boundaries are like building a fence around the pit. The idea is not to see how close you can get without falling in. The idea is to protect you can keep you safe. That said, I do think the boundaries depend on the couple. Some people will be okay with kissing and others won't. It's about what you and the other person feel comfortable with. And you boundaries can definitely change over time. Maybe you think you'd be okay with making out, but then you do and it stirs up desires and you decide that no, it brings you too close to temptation so you decide not to. I definitely agree that it needs to be an ongoing conversation with your girlfriend/boyfriend.

I was always taught that in order to keep the “big rules”, you have to keep the “little ones”. In order to not crash your car, you need to make sure that you aren’t ignoring traffic laws, using your phone, letting people/music distract you, etc. You can still cross way too many lines without full on having sex. Boundaries are not a bad thing to have and I think you should make sure to continually check on yours to see if you need to readjust anything.

Our boundaries were very similar. We adjusted as we went, sometimes deciding to move forward, other times pulling back and praying together if we felt like we went a little too far. Our main rule was to never be in either his apartment or my parents house alone. We spent a LOT of time in a car or other public places. If his roommate wasn’t home We would just sit outside the apartment in the car and talk. It gave us a measure accountability, but privacy to talk as well. We did a lot of restaurant sitting and activities during our dating/engagement when we couldn’t have someone else in the house with us.

Great questions and answers. There really is no set standards and rules. It is about personal relationship with God and what you feel He is guiding you toward. I really feel that in the Christian circle, we expect people to marry young, have many children, have short courtships, and short engagements. 1 Corinthians 7:9 is often used to support short courtships and engagements. Paul talks about the calling of celibacy in this passage and challenges as to whether it is the right calling for an individual. I often hear many Christians say that if you want to have sex with someone, that is God's sign that you are supposed to get married. That is not the benchmark or standard to get married and it is so misleading to guide young men and women in that false standard. Marriage is built on so much more than physical intimacy. Marriage is to emulate the love that Christ has for the Church and that is built on something different than just sex and physical intimacy. We miss stressing the importance of sharing values, goals, knowing one another's standards on finances, family, careers, division of labour, faith, etc.

We blow by our boundaries because we are only looking at the actions and we ignore the emotions. Emotions lead to actions and actions lead to more and deeper emotions which result in more and deeper actions. You see they must be accounted for together because often the emotions are much farther along then the actions. So if you’re feeling extra frisky to start then you are already closer to the point of no return so to speak so you may need to limit your actions sooner sometimes. Point of no return = slave to self.

Q3, I agree, don't feel bad about saving your kiss. It's counter-culture in our hyper-sexualized society. But ignore what people say. If I had it to do over again, I would have saved my first kiss for the wedding. The world places huge importance on the physical chemistry of a relationship, but it's actually a hindrance to finding the right spouse to marry because it starts the bonding process. You develop "feelings" for the other person before you know if the person is right for you. This leads into Q9. Focus on the spiritual, emotional and companionship aspects of your relationship as you date and learn about each other. The physical should be the last road to take, or I should say the least important. Yes, everyone's road is different, and everyone needs to decide for themselves what is right for them. But as someone who crossed boundaries in dating I found it's better to err on the side of being too strict. If the 51 year old me could have talked to the 18 year old me my boundaries would have been very different and I wouldn't have adjusted them in response to momentary desires. Unfortunately, memories of mistakes you make with someone you don't end up marrying stay with you forever. Forgiven, sure, but not erased. Boundaries can be adjusted, cautiously forward, or backward after realizing it was too much, but don't do it in the heat of the moment. It should be a pre-planned, level-headed decision that's appropriate for where you are in your relationship.
